Michael Kennaugh (b. Casper, Wyoming, 1964) has spent most of his life in Texas and currently lives and works in Houston, Texas.  He received a B.F.A. degree from Lamar University (1986) and a M.F.A. degree in painting from the University of North Texas (1990).  He also attended The American College of Switzerland in Leysin (1990) and was awarded an artist residency (1996) at the William Flanagan Memorial Creative Persons Center, Montauk, Long Island.  Kennaugh’s work is in the permanent collections of The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ston; Art Museum of Southeast Texas, Beaumont; Houston Airport System, City of Houston; Lamar University, Beaumont; Tyler Museum of Art; and the Mobile Museum of Art, as well as private and corporate collections both national and international.  Kennaugh’s work is currently on view at the Dishman Art Museum at Lamar University and will also be included in an upcoming exhibition at The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ston.  A solo exhibition of his work was held at the Beeville Art Museum (2022).
